Job Summary:
Professional for general administrative activities, campaign support, conflict management, apprentice supervision, third-party control, supply management, and monthly financial closing of the unit.
Key Highlights:
1. Direct interface with managers and administrative coordination
2. Conflict management and team relationship
3. Preparation of managerial reports and presentations
**General Administrative Activities**
* Direct interface with the unit manager and administrative coordination of the Jandira factory.
* Organization and follow-up of local administrative processes, aligned with corporate managers.
* Support in corporate campaigns (Saint\-Gobain, P\&G), training sessions, and safety and health events.
* Coordination of internal surveys and adherence to deadlines set by the production coordinator.
* Support to employees regarding benefit plans, benefits administration, and communication with the labor union.
* Conflict management and relationship with the shop-floor team.
* Supervision of two young apprentices, providing guidance on projects and simple administrative tasks.
* Administrative control of third-party contractors (contracts and interface with supervisors from outsourced companies).
* Management of cleaning services and uniform distribution.
* Receiving and inspection of supplies and materials in the warehouse.
* Periodic inventory of parts, supplies, and products (sand).
* Monthly closing with mass balance and unit cost analysis.
* Verification of invoices and taxes (including VAT).
* Invoice entry into SAP and verification of accounting accounts.
* Monitoring of provisioned and allocated amounts.
* Responsibility for the unit’s monthly closing, with support from the manager.
* Preparation of managerial reports and periodic presentations for local and regional managers.
* Frequent use of Excel and PowerPoint for data consolidation and results communication.
* Coverage of colleagues’ vacation periods in the administrative area, assuming additional responsibilities.
* Support to industrial and automotive maintenance.
* Ensuring continuity of administrative operations during absences.
